This paper describes the development of a thermally regulated enclosure for standard resistor elements. The design, using a Peltier element, can work in a wide range of possible laboratory temperatures, with mK stability. Combined with a high quality resistance element, a robust working standard with 10−9 level relative stability is produced.
This paper describes realization in Poland of new system for resistance unit transfer from 10 kΩ to 100 TΩ, based on Hamon transfers. The new design of those transfers and their properties has been presented. Currently this system is being tested in Central Office of Measures in Poland.

In this work we present precision measurements of the integer quantum Hall effect in exfoliated graphene on GaAs substrate. In a relatively large graphene Hall bar area (150 µm long and 30 µm wide) dissipationless quantum Hall state was maintained up to about 10 µA and Hall resistance revealed plateau quantization with an accuracy of a few parts per billion.
